The Lakers have been on a hiring spree in the past couple of days, first hiring Darvin Ham to fill in for former head coach Frank Vogel. Ham is a highly respected coaching prospect, and looks to corral the circus that is the modern LA Lakers. In order to do so, Ham has brought on former four-time NBA All-Star Rasheed Wallace to the coaching staff. Wallace spent the last year as an assistant coach under Penny Hardaway at the University of Memphis. Wallace’s relationship with Darvin Ham goes all the way back to 2004, where the two won an NBA Championship together while on the Detroit Pistons. Penny Hardaway, Wallace’s former colleague, said that Wallace’s plan was always to team up with Darvin. If Darvin had gotten a job last year, Rasheed had already promised him that he was going to go with him. So, I’m thinking this year, with him getting the Lakers job, (Wallace) might still be going along with that process.”

Wallace, 47, played 16 seasons in the NBA after starring for the University of North Carolina. He played for Washington, Portland, Atlanta, Detroit, Boston, and New York throughout his career.
